Self-Evaluation (as assmt tool before / after term test / exam) : Self-Evaluation (as assmt tool before / after term test / exam) let Ss check against the required aims/ objectives
Keep the checklist & give them after test/exam
< How to set….? >
May use the lesson objectives …
OR T/F questions about simple concepts
OR use Ss’ wrong phrases as stems…
Self-eval (2)…. Example T/F (concept analysis) : Self-eval (2)…. Example T/F (concept analysis) An aqueous solution of an ionic compound contains mobile ions.
All ionic compounds are soluble in water
Diamond and graphite are isotopes
When a covalent compound melts, the atoms in the molecules separate
Silicon dioxide is a giant structure held by van der Waals forces

Standard-referenced assessment: : Standard-referenced assessment: Based on the learning outcomes of the curriculum and report students’ results against a hierarchy of described levels of achievement based on typical performances of students at that level
Students’ results indicate their standards achieved in terms of knowledge, skills and understanding rather than in terms of the performance of other students taking the same examination
Elements of standard-referenced assessment: : Elements of standard-referenced assessment: A curriculum with clear learning outcomes
Descriptions of different levels of performance
Examples of tasks students are asked to do
Samples of students’ responses (exemplars)
Standards-setting
Format of reporting results
